What Are Lines On A Map Called – The lines on a surface map are called isobars. Isobars are lines of constant pressure which are measured in units called millibars. The numbers indicate the amount of air pressure, in millibars . Map symbols show what can be found in an area. Each feature of the landscape has a different symbol.
